Because gay excludes lesbians, bisexuals, and transgendered
individuals, and queer is a reclaimed term. LGBTQ is too long,
confusing, and not recognized as much as queer.
2. How did queerTX.org get started?
queerTX (originally queerUT) was launched October 3, 2001 right
before Pride Week as a place to bring people together.
Each October, the queerTX community holds a rally, workshops,
lectures and parties around October 11: National Coming Out
Day.
In October 2001 it became PRIDE WEEK on UT-Austin's campus. |
